Journalist Salary in Chicago, Illinois

The median journalist salary in Chicago, IL is $59,877 per year, which is 7.0% above the national median and 12.6% above the Illinois state average.

Journalist Salary in Chicago by Experience

In Chicago, an entry-level journalist earns around $37,450, while experienced professionals earn up to $107,000 per year. The local cost of living index is 107% of the national average.

Job Outlook

Nationally, journalist employment is projected to grow -3% over the next decade (decline). Demand in Chicago may vary based on local industry and population growth.
